On Wednesday 2nd April, Sounds and Colours’ editor Russell Slater will be giving a talk in Nottingham about the Sounds and Colours Brazil book and CD.

Using music and images, the talk will aim to show another side of Brazilian music and culture, that goes far beyond bossa nova, City of God and football, exploring contemporary music, literature, arts and film in depth.

The talk will cost £3 on the door (and includes a free can of Guaraná), with the entrance fee redeemable against any purchase. This means your £3 entrance fee will be discounted when you buy a copy of the Sounds and Colours Brazil book/CD.

The event will be happening at Five Leaves Bookshop in Nottingham city centre on Wednesday 2nd April at 7.30pm. You can find out more about the event at fiveleavesbookshop.co.uk/events
